Chantilly, VA - January 11, 2010 - InfinityQS® International announced today that The Pepsi Bottling Group, Inc. (PBG) has implemented ProFicient 4, the industry leading Statistical Process Control (SPC) software, throughout its global manufacturing facilities. PBG is using InfinityQS' SPC technology to provide immediate global visibility and quality control in over 90 plants spanning the United States, Canada, Greece, Mexico, Russia, Spain, and Turkey.
ProFicient 4 is being used by PBG to create a centralized lab management system for statistical analysis and control of their global manufacturing operations. The system enables all manufacturing sites to ensure they are in compliance with PBG's strict quality standards for all phases of product manufacturing from raw materials to the finished product. By leveraging InfinityQS' Data Management System (DMS) to communicate directly with PBG's lab and manufacturing equipment, ProFicient 4 creates an efficient, integrated system to manage and control process data.
"We take great pride in the efficiency and effectiveness of our global manufacturing operations, and InfinityQS is a trusted partner in our efforts to constantly improve our results," said Tanya Peacock, corporate quality engineer at PBG. "Proficient 4 is an easy-to-use, flexible and centralized system that provides us with real-time access to performance information at all of our plants around the world. This allows us to instantly compare information, identify best practices, and quickly replicate our success on a global scale."
InfinityQS released ProFicient 4 in June to further address food manufacturers' needs for an enterprise quality system that supports HACCP, SSOP and Net Content Control compliance. Among the many new features in ProFicient 4 is the ability to incorporate workflow capabilities to individual workstations and prompt data collection in the necessary intervals with a real-time dynamic scheduler.

About PBG The Pepsi Bottling Group, Inc.is the world's largest manufacturer, seller and distributor of Pepsi-Cola beverages. With approximately 67,000 employees and annual sales of nearly $14 billion, PBG has operations in the U.S., Canada, Greece, Mexico, Russia, Spain and Turkey.
